How did a final discuss change open opinion polls?
The rematch between Mr. Biden and Ms. Harris has been billed as the must-see pairing of tonight’s presidential debate. But while a Jun discuss featured a rootless opening by Mr. Biden, and a dermatitis one by Ms. Harris as she challenged his record on race, it is tough to find most justification that their initial matchup had a durability outcome on open opinion.
Just over a month later, Mr. Biden binds a support of 32 percent of Democratic voters, according to a latest RealClearPolitics average. It’s accurately what he hold streamer into a Jun debate. He fell to 26 percent in a week that followed that initial debate, though he has recovered scarcely all of a support he lost.
Ms. Harris’ breakthrough did not infer durable, either. She quickly surged to about 15 percent, good for a three-way tie with Senator Elizabeth Warren and Mr. Sanders in second place. But Ms. Harris has slipped behind to around 11 percent in a latest polls, about median in between her post-debate rise and a 7 percent she hold streamer into a contest.
It’s a sign that a debates, notwithstanding their high viewership, don’t always have a durability outcome on a race. A call of certain headlines can pitch a polls, though aren’t guaranteed to move about a durability change in open opinion.
